Suspect in 7–11 robbery is arrested

A Pennypack Woods man has been arrested for last month’s armed robbery of a local 7-Eleven store.

Police say that Brien Boedeker, 33, of the 8600 block of Deer Lane, entered the 7-Eleven at 9901 Frankford Ave. at 6:20 a.m. on Nov. 1, asked a clerk for a pack of cigarettes, then pulled a handgun and demanded money. The employee opened and removed the cash drawer from the register and placed it on the sales counter. Boedeker allegedly grabbed $280 and fled.

On Nov. 14, police received information that a man fitting the description of the robber was driving a Jeep on Frankford Avenue. Using this information, investigators identified Boedeker as the robber and arrested him on Nov. 15.

He was charged with robbery, weapons violations, assault and related offenses. He remains in jail in lieu of $250,000 bail and is scheduled for a Dec. 6 preliminary hearing. ••
